Footwear
Interlining is a crucial auxiliary material in shoe production, playing a significant role from shaping the upper to providing a comfortable experience inside the shoes

Shape retention & structure support
Interlinings help maintain the shape of shoe uppers, ensuring they don't easily deform during wearing. For example, in leather shoes, the interlining reinforces the toe cap area, keeping it in a proper arc shape for a neat and stylish look, and also supports the overall structure of the shoe to enhance durability.
Comfort enhancement
It can improve the comfort inside the shoes. Some interlinings with good breathability and soft texture are used in the shoe lining, which can absorb sweat, reduce friction between the foot and the shoe, and make walking more comfortable, especially suitable for sports shoes and casual shoes.
Adhesion & layering assistance
In the process of shoe making, interlinings assist in the adhesion of different layers of materials (such as upper, lining, etc.). They can make the bonding between layers more stable, prevent delamination, and ensure the shoes have a solid structure, which is very important for the quality of shoes like high - heeled shoes with complex structures.
Moisture management
Certain interlinings can help manage moisture inside shoes. By absorbing and wicking away moisture, they keep the shoe interior dry, reducing the risk of odor and bacterial growth, which is beneficial for maintaining foot health, especially in shoes that are worn for long periods.
Garment
Interlinings are fundamental and crucial materials in clothing production, influencing the stiffness of the garment's appearance, wearing comfort, and durability.

Garment shaping & stiffness
Interlinings are used to give garments a nice shape and appropriate stiffness. In suits, for instance, the interlining in the collar and front panels makes the collar stand upright and the front look flat and neat, enhancing the overall tailored appearance and making the suit more formal and stylish.
Drapability improvement
It can optimize the drapability of fabrics. For dresses and skirts, using suitable interlinings can make the fabric hang more naturally and elegantly, showing a better silhouette, whether it's a flowing chiffon dress or a structured wool skirt.
Durability & wear resistance
Interlinings add durability to garments. In areas prone to wear, like the cuffs and hems of shirts, interlinings can reduce friction and wear, making the garment last longer, which is practical for daily - worn clothes such as work shirts and casual tops.
Wrinkle resistance
They contribute to wrinkle resistance. Garments with interlinings are less likely to wrinkle, keeping a neat look throughout the day. This is especially valuable for business attire and formal wear, reducing the need for frequent ironing.
Automobile
In car interiors and other parts, interlinings are related to the driving and riding experience, interior aesthetics and functionality

Interior comfort & feel
Interlinings are used in car interiors to enhance comfort and tactile feel. In car seats, soft and breathable interlinings can make the seats more comfortable to sit on, reducing the stuffy feeling during long - term driving, and also improve the touch of the seat surface, giving a more luxurious feel.
Noise reduction & insulation
They can help with noise reduction and heat insulation inside the car. Interlinings installed in car door panels and roof linings can absorb and block external noise, creating a quieter driving environment, and also reduce heat transfer, keeping the car interior temperature more stable, which is beneficial for energy - saving air - conditioning operation.
Interior shaping & aesthetics
Interlinings assist in shaping car interior components and improving aesthetics. In car dashboards and door trims, they help these parts maintain a smooth and neat shape, enhancing the overall interior design sense, and can also be used to cover up unevenness of the base materials, making the interior look more refined.
Fire resistance & safety
Some special interlinings for cars have fire - resistant properties. In case of fire danger in the car, they can slow down the spread of flames, providing more escape time for passengers, and also meet the strict fire - safety regulations of the automotive industry, ensuring driving safety.
Medical
In the medical field, interlinings play a role in aspects such as medical textiles and nursing products, focusing on hygiene, comfort, and auxiliary treatment.

Hygiene & infection control
Interlinings used in medical textiles, such as in surgical gowns and patient bedding, play a role in hygiene and infection control. They can be made of antibacterial materials to prevent the growth of bacteria, reducing the risk of cross - infection in medical environments, ensuring a clean and safe environment for patients and medical staff.
Wound dressing assistance
In wound dressings, some soft and breathable interlinings can be used as the contact layer with the wound. They are gentle on the wound, absorb wound exudate, keep the wound moist for healing, and also provide a protective barrier to prevent external contamination, helping wounds recover better.
Patient comfort in medical devices
Interlinings are applied in medical devices to improve patient comfort. In orthopedic braces and supports, soft interlinings can reduce skin irritation and pressure sores caused by long - term wearing, making patients more comfortable during treatment and rehabilitation, which is conducive to the smooth progress of the treatment process.
Absorbency & fluid management
Certain medical interlinings have good absorbency for fluid management. In incontinence products and medical absorbent pads, they can quickly absorb and lock in body fluids, keeping the patient's skin dry, reducing the risk of skin problems, and also maintaining the integrity and effectiveness of the medical product.
